9.4 Causes and Corrective Actions

AL001
Over current
Causes
The drive output is
short-circuited.
The motor wiring is in error.
IGBT is abnormal.
The setting of control
parameter is in error.
The setting of control
command is in error.
AL002
Over voltage
Causes
The input voltage of the main
circuit is higher than the
rated allowable voltage.
Wrong power input
(incorrect power system)
The hardware of the servo
drive is damaged.
AL003
Under voltage
Causes
The input voltage of the main
circuit is lower than the rated
allowable voltage.
No power supply for the
main circuit
Wrong power input
(incorrect power
system)
AL004
Motor combination error
Causes
The encoder is damaged.
The encoder is loose.
Motor combination error
